摘要: 在快速发展的高铁时代,为明确高速铁路运营组织管理中许多问题的解决途径,选择最早运营高速铁路的日本新干线为对象,以实际运行数据为基础,通过横向和纵向比较,分析其运营组织管理手段与措施,对我国高铁发展中的相关问题加以判断.研究认为,高铁发展不宜过快,应与普通铁路实现同站经营,并开行多停车方案列车,尽量挖掘600 km以内的竞争优势,实施票价动态调节机制,将能耗与排放控制放在首位.研究结论可为我国高速铁路的持续健康发展提供参考.

Abstract: Under the background of the rapid development of high-speed railway in China, the paper analyzes the world’s first operational highspeed railway—Japan Shinkansen to get a clear solution to the problems of the organization and management operations of high-speed railway. On the basis of actual operating data, the means and measures in organization and operational management of Japan Shinkansen are evaluated by horizontal and vertical comparison. And then, the paper makes the judgment to the related issues of the development of China’s high-speed railway. Some conclusions are made, such as, the development speed should not be too fast. The high-speed railway should be operated at the same railway station with the traditional railway with multiparking program train. The competitive advantage within 600 km should be extensively explored. And it is essential to conduct scientific fare adjustment mechanism and put the energy consumption and emissions in the first place. The research provides reference for high-speed railway sustained and healthy development in China.
